    i can not get the air breather back on to save my life

    • @tylerwhite7314
      @tylerwhite7314 3 года назад

      Same problem!!! Please tell me you figured it out

    • @Lamar4ya
      @Lamar4ya 3 года назад

      @@tylerwhite7314 Have to connect the air breather to the carburetor while the carburetor is off the motor then It bolts back onto the motor with ease
